Ah, Santiago Oaks, yes one of my favorite places to ride. I've only been on the main trails there, Chutes, Waterfall, and the 3 B's climbing up. There are a few more other trails in there that I haven't been on. We, my g/f and I usually take the main trail up, stop at Robber's peak to rest and head down the single track to the ride towards Chutes then back out. You can also link up with the Weir Canyon Loop. The junction is located to your left when you come down the singletrack from the "Play Area" by the powerlines. Instead of taking the left down Chutes off the singletrack, you can take the right and go down Waterfall which is a pretty technical. I know this may sound confusing, but I'm sure there are a lot more other users on here that can give you detailed directions.

Check out the book Mountain Biking Orange County. It has some information on this trail.
